What is the cheapest month to fly from Washington, D.C. to Leeds?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Washington, D.C. to Leeds,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Washington, D.C. to Leeds is January, where tickets cost $665 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and May,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,142 and $939 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Washington, D.C. to Leeds?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Leeds with an airline and back to Washington, D.C. with another airline.
